Ingredient notes

  • Peanut butter. I only use natural peanut butter in this recipe as it includes just peanut butter and salt. If you choose to use a different type of peanut butter, you may encounter a different outcome with your cookies.
  • Oats. The texture of these cookies is very soft, so I added oats for a nice chewy texture. Instant oats or rolled oats may be used, or omit them altogether.
  • Maple syrup. Pure maple syrup is best for quality and flavor, or you may substitute it with honey. Coconut or granulated sugar may be used, but it may affect the texture of the cookies.
  • Chocolate chips. Dark chocolate is lower in sugar and gives these cookies big chocolate flavor. They may be substituted with whatever you have on hand.

Recipe FAQs

Can you use natural peanut butter in cookies?

Natural peanut butter works very well in these flourless peanut butter cookies, and is the type that I prefer. You can use your favorite variety, but the texture of the cookies will vary slightly depending on the type you use.

What popular cookies are gluten-free?

Flourless Peanut Butter Cookies are a very popular gluten-free cookies for good reason. They’re packed with peanut butter, include no butter or oil, no refined sugar and they’re ready in about 30 minutes from start to finish!

How do you make peanut butter cookies better?

Great peanut butter cookies start with high quality peanut butter that has just peanuts and salt for maximum peanut butter flavor. Adding chocolate chips is always a good idea, and a light sprinkle of sea salt really enhances the flavor.

Recipe notes

  • Pro tip: The best type of peanut butter to use in these flourless peanut butter oatmeal cookies isnatural peanut butter, which only includes peanut butter and salt. Natural peanut butter is the only kind of peanut butter that I’ve used in this recipe, so if you choose to use a different type of peanut butter the texture may vary.
  • The oats may be omitted if you’d like to make your cookies grain free.
  • Cookies may be stored in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 5 days. They will stick together slightly, so separating them with a sheet of parchment or waxed paper is a good idea.

Flourless Peanut Butter Cookies

Servings: 20 cookies

Prep Time: 10 minutes mins

Cook Time: 10 minutes mins

Additional Time: 0 minutes mins

Total Time: 20 minutes mins

Flourless Peanut Butter Cookies are easy gluten-free cookies cookies packed with peanut butter, chewy oats and dark chocolate! They're so easy to make and are ready in about 30 minutes!

Ingredients

  • 1 cup natural peanut butter (ingredients are only peanuts and salt)
  • 1/2 cup maple syrup or the same amount of your favorite sweetener
  • 1 large egg
  • 1/2 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1/2 cup quick oats use rolled oats for an even chewier texture
  • 1/3 cup dark chocolate chips
  • 1 teaspoon flaky sea salt

Instructions

  •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.

  • Place the peanut butter, maple syrup, egg, baking soda and vanilla in a medium bowl and beat on medium speed with a hand mixer until combined.

  • Stir in the oats and dark chocolate chips.

  • Using a 1 1/2″ cookie scoop, scoop the cookie batter (about a heaping tablespoon of batter) and place on the prepared baking sheet about an inch and a half apart. Flatten the cookies slightly with the palm of your hand as they won’t spread while baking.

  • Bake for 10 minutes or until set, then remove from heat and sprinkle the tops of the cookies with the flaky sea salt and place on a wire rack to cool. Serve and enjoy!

Notes

  • The oats may be omitted if you’d like to make your cookies grain free.
  • The best type of peanut butter to use in these flourless peanut butter oatmeal cookies isnatural peanut butter, which only includes peanut butter and salt. Natural peanut butter is the only kind of peanut butter that I’ve used in this recipe, so if you choose to use a different type of peanut butter, you may encounter a different outcome with your cookies.
  • Cookies may be stored in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 5 days. They will stick together slightly, so separating them with a sheet of parchment or waxed paper is a good idea.

Nutrition

Serving: 1cookie, Calories: 139kcal, Carbohydrates: 12g, Protein: 3g, Fat: 8g, Saturated Fat: 2g, Sodium: 191mg, Fiber: 1g, Sugar: 7g
